Exciting Outpatient Primary Care Opportunity in San Francisco and San Mateo, CA. Responsibilities

Work with family, general internal physicians, women’s health and pediatricians. Seven or eight 1/2-day clinical sessions per week. 20% protected administrative time (two half-days weekly) for administrative duties, quality improvement projects, and creative activity. Monday through Friday hours only — no inpatient or weekend clinic scheduling. Medical student teaching if desired. Competitive and stable compensation. Generous benefits include 403(b) and 457 retirement plans, CME and board certification allowance, malpractice, life and disability insurance, health, dental and vision benefits, plus more. Qualifications

California licensed physician (MD or DO) by start date with board certification or eligibility and willingness to become board certified in Family Medicine. Compensation and Benefits

UC Pension Plan 403(b) & 457(b) Retirement Savings Plans, Defined Contribution Plan CME & Board Certification Allowance Malpractice, Life and Disability Insurance Health, Dental & Vision Benefits Plus many more For positions that are 51% effort or more: The posted UC salary scales set the minimum pay determined by rank and step at appointment. The minimum base salary range for this position is $140,600-$369,000. This position includes membership in the health sciences compensation plan which provides for eligibility for additional compensation. For positions that are 50% effort or less: See Table 2 for the salary range for this position. A reasonable estimate for this position is $93,700-$246,000. Application Process
